What can you expect as a Quality Control Operative Working upon Crown’s Hull site as part of this role, you’ll be working at the heart of our business, testing. Key responsibilities include:

  • Use prescribed test methods to test paint and raw materials according to the products specification and make adjustments or additions to meet the specification and colour tinting requirements as necessary.
  • React to plant issues to maintain maximum production flow with minimum disruption and downtime whilst maintaining optimum product quality.
  • Calibrate & maintain departmental equipment in line with established procedures
  • Accurately maintain the quality database and SAP system records
  • Ensure inventory accuracy using techniques such as cycle counting.
  • Maintain the highest standards of plant hygiene through regulartesting and controlling to the required standards
  • Supporting Crown Paint’s Sustainability commitment by eliminating or reducing waste, and ensuring any waste generated is processed through appropriate streams.
  • Active participation in Continuous Improvement activities, examples of such being 6S, 5 Box (Why, Why) Analysis, Kaizen.
